#3b3b5d hex color
In a RGB color space, hex #3b3b5d is composed of 23.1% red, 23.1% green and 36.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 36.6% cyan, 36.6% magenta, 0% yellow and 63.5% black. It has a hue angle of 240 degrees, a saturation of 22.4% and a lightness of 29.8%. #3b3b5d color hex could be obtained by blending #7676ba with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#333366.

● #3b3b5d color description : Very dark desaturated blue.
The hexadecimal color #3b3b5d has RGB values of R:59, G:59, B:93 and CMYK values of C:0.37, M:0.37, Y:0, K:0.64. Its decimal value is 3881821.
